    The Connection Between Website Speed and User Experience

    Website speed is crucial in determining user experience. Studies have shown that users have little patience for slow-loading websites. If a site takes more than a few seconds to load, visitors will likely abandon it in favor of faster alternatives.

    In fact, when your website takes 5 seconds to load, your bounce rate is poised to increase by a staggering 90%!

    Slow-loading pages are a common source of frustration for users, leading to elevated bounce rates and a decline in overall user engagement.

    On the flip side, as per Portent’s study, if a site loads in one second, it has an average conversion rate of 39%.

    SEO and Website Speed

    Website speed is a crucial ranking factor in SEO. That is why website owners choose the fastest WordPress Hosting.

    Search engines, especially Google, consider page load time as one of the factors when determining search rankings. A faster website is more likely to rank higher in search results than a slower one with similar content.

    Google’s commitment to delivering a positive user experience has led to its emphasis on website speed. Since 2010, Google has incorporated website speed into its ranking algorithms to encourage webmasters to prioritize performance.

    Statistics show that faster websites tend to receive more organic traffic and visibility. A study by HubSpot revealed that 47% of consumers expect a web page to load in 2 seconds or less.

    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O) and Website Speed

    Faster-loading websites lead to a better user experience, encouraging visitors to stay longer and engage with your content, products, or services, increasing the chances of conversion.

    Multiple studies support the link between website speed and conversion rates. For instance, a study by Walmart revealed that for every 1-second improvement in page load time, they experienced a 2% increase in the conversion rate.

    To leverage website speed for better conversion rates, consider the following best practices:

    1. Optimize Images

    Images are integral to web content and can significantly impact website speed if not optimized properly. Compressing images without compromising their quality is essential to reduce page load times.

    Large image files can slow down your website, leading to higher bounce rates and lower user engagement. You can check the best WordPress image optimization plugins to reduce the size of your images on your site.

    2. Minimize HTTP Requests

    When users visit a web page, their browser sends HTTP requests to the server for every element, including images, stylesheets, scripts, and more. Each request takes time, and the more requests a page has, the longer it will take to load. Reducing the number of elements on a page is crucial to minimize server requests.

    Combining CSS and JavaScript files can help in reducing the number of requests. Additionally, using CSS sprites for multiple images can also reduce server requests. CSS sprites combine numerous images into one image, and then specific portions of that image are displayed on the page as needed.

    3. Enable Browser Caching

    Browser caching is a technique that stores static resources from your website, such as images, CSS, and JavaScript files, on a user’s device. You can use the Breeze caching plugin to do this.

    When the user revisits the website, the cached resources are used, eliminating the need to fetch them from the server again. This can significantly speed up subsequent visits and reduce page load times.

    You must set appropriate expiration dates for cacheable resources to enable browser caching. By setting longer expiration times, you’ll ensure that the user’s browser keeps the resources in its cache for a more extended period, resulting in faster loading times for repeat visitors.

    4. Use a Content Delivery Network (CDN)

    A Content Delivery Network (CDN) is a network of servers located in different geographical locations. The best CDN out there is definitely Cloudflare. You can leverage this CDN on a budget if you go for the Cloudways Cloudflare Enterprise CDN.

    When a user accesses your website, the CDN identifies the closest server to the user’s location and delivers the website’s content. It reduces latency and improves loading speed, especially for geographically distant users from your website’s origin server.

    A CDN is particularly helpful for websites with a global audience or heavy traffic. It distributes the website’s content across multiple servers, ensuring that users experience fast load times regardless of their location.

    Mobile Responsiveness and Website Speed

    Mobile Responsiveness and Website Speed

    With the increasing adoption of mobile devices, optimizing your website for mobile responsiveness is crucial. Mobile users expect fast-loading pages just as much as desktop users.

    Mobile users are often on the go and have even less patience for slow-loading pages. A study by Google found that 53% of mobile users abandon a site if it takes more than 3 seconds to load.

    To optimize your website for mobile responsiveness and speed, consider the following strategies:

    1. Implement Accelerated Mobile Pages (AMP)

    Accelerated Mobile Pages (AMP) is an open-source framework developed by Google to accelerate page load times on mobile devices. Using streamlined HTML and CSS, AMP pages load quickly and provide users with a better mobile experience.

    AMP optimizes the performance of web pages by removing unnecessary elements and prioritizing essential content. It restricts certain HTML tags and encourages best practices for efficient mobile rendering.

    2. Optimize for Mobile-First Indexing

    Search engines have shifted their focus to mobile-first indexing as mobile usage dominates internet traffic. The mobile version of a website is now the primary version considered by search engines when ranking pages.

    Adopt a mobile-first approach to design and development to ensure your website performs well on mobile-first indexing. Start with a mobile-friendly layout and then scale up to larger screens.

    This approach ensures that all users, regardless of their device, have a positive experience when interacting with your website

    3. Use Responsive Images

    Serving appropriately sized images based on the user’s device helps minimize load times and improve overall performance. After all, responsive images are a vital component of a mobile-friendly website.

    The “Srcset” attribute is a crucial element in delivering responsive images. It allows web developers to provide multiple image sources, each tailored to different screen resolutions.

    By including various image sizes, your website can deliver the most appropriate image for the user’s screen size and resolution, reducing the time it takes to load images.

    Brand Reputation and Website Speed

    Website speed significantly impacts brand perception. A slow-loading website can create a negative impression of your brand, making users perceive it as unreliable and outdated.

    To maintain a positive brand reputation through website speed optimization, focus on the following strategies:

    1. Regularly Monitor Website Speed

    Regular monitoring of website speed is essential to ensure optimal performance. Real-time monitoring allows you to stay on top of potential problems and take immediate action to address them. You can use the New Relic tool for application monitoring.

    2. Optimize Server Performance

    The choice of a hosting provider and the performance of your server infrastructure significantly impact website speed. Opt for a reliable hosting provider that offers robust server resources and ensures minimal downtime.

    Increasing RAM or processing power can improve your website’s response time and loading speed, enhancing the user experience.

    3. Continuously Test and Optimize

    Website speed optimization is an ongoing process that requires continuous testing and improvement.

    Regularly test your website’s speed and performance using various website speed testing tools like Google PageSpeed Insights and GTmetrix for valuable insights into your website’s performance and offer suggestions for improvement.

    Implementing the suggested improvements and conducting A/B testing can help evaluate the impact of speed optimization on user behavior and conversion rates.

    A/B testing involves creating two web page versions with different loading speeds and comparing their performance. You can determine which version performs better regarding user engagement and conversion rates.

    Website speed optimization requires continuous monitoring, analysis, and improvements. There are numerous tools available to help you gauge and improve your website’s performance.

    1. Google PageSpeed Insights

    Google PageSpeed Insights is a website speed testing tool developed by Google that provides comprehensive insights into a website’s performance and user experience. By analyzing a webpage, it generates a score based on various speed metrics, offering suggestions for improvement.

    2. GTmetrix

    GTmetrix is a powerful website speed-testing tool that uses various browsers to assess a webpage’s performance from multiple locations. This tool provides in-depth reports on loading times, page size, and the number of requests made by the webpage.

    3. Pingdom Tools

    Pingdom Tools allows website owners and developers to test the loading speed of their websites from different locations worldwide. Analyzing various aspects of website performance offers a comprehensive overview of how quickly a website loads and how it compares to industry benchmarks.

    When a user enters a website URL into Pingdom Tools, it initiates a performance test by simulating a user’s visit to the site. The tool measures the time to load each webpage element, including HTML, CSS, JavaScript, images, and other resources.

    This data is then presented in an easy-to-understand format, highlighting performance grades, load times, and detailed insights into potential bottlenecks affecting speed.

    Real-Life Case Studies

    The impact of website speed on digital marketing success cannot be overstated. In fact, several case studies have shown how crucial it is to prioritize website speed to achieve optimal results. Let’s take a look at some real-life examples:

    Case Study 1: Walmart

    In 2012, Walmart conducted an experiment to determine the impact of website speed on their online sales. They found that for every 1 second of improvement in page load time, their conversions increased by 2%. By optimizing its website speed, Walmart was able to boost its online sales by a whopping 10%.

    Case Study 2: Pinterest

    In 2014, Pinterest increased its website speed by 40% and saw a 15% increase in its search engine traffic and sign-ups. Additionally, their time on site increased by 40%. This resulted in higher engagement rates and increased user satisfaction.

    Case Study 3: AutoAnything

    AutoAnything, an online retailer of automotive parts and accessories, increased its website speed by 50% and saw a 12-13% increase in its conversion rates. This led to a significant increase in revenue and customer retention.

    These case studies clearly demonstrate the importance of website speed in digital marketing success. Faster loading times lead to lower bounce rates, higher conversion rates, and increased customer satisfaction and engagement. On the other hand, slow websites suffer from decreased organic traffic and lower search engine rankings. 

    By prioritizing website speed, businesses can achieve higher customer retention and greater success in their digital marketing efforts.
